The FJH Keyboard Chord Encyclopedia is a quick reference guide containing the most common chords and chord voicings used in folk, jazz, and popular music. This book is written especially for keyboardists - both novice and professional - who work with popular music by ear, or use lead sheets, etc. The encyclopedia is organized chromatically into chapters, starting with C and progressing upward through B. Enharmonic chapters are also included.
